Second Fatality Confirmed in Caledon Triple Shooting

Triple Shooting in Caledon

A tragic incident that occurred at a residence on Mayfield Road in Caledon last month has claimed a second life, the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) confirmed today.

The shooting incident took place shortly before midnight on November 20, resulting in the death of a 57-year-old man from Caledon. Two other individuals were also injured and rushed to the hospital.

Unfortunately, one of the transported victims, identified as a 55-year-old woman from Caledon, has since succumbed to her injuries, bringing the total number of fatalities to two. The authorities have decided not to release her name at this time.

The third victim remains in critical condition and continues to receive treatment at the hospital.

Multiple Suspects Involved

The OPP has disclosed that they believe multiple suspects were involved in the shooting incident, although their identities have yet to be determined.

Witnesses reported seeing one of the suspects entering a black pick-up truck, which was observed heading westbound on Mayfield Road. In a subsequent development, investigators believe the same truck was later found engulfed in flames near Olde Baseline Road and Creditview Road in a separate vehicle fire incident.

In their efforts to gather more evidence, the police previously released a photograph of the suspect’s vehicle and are urging anyone with relevant footage to come forward and assist the ongoing investigation.

Plea for Information and Surveillance Footage

Investigators are appealing to the public for any footage or information that may shed light on the events that unfolded between 11 p.m. and 12:30 a.m. in Caledon on the night of the shooting.

The authorities emphasize that there is currently no immediate threat to public safety, but they continue to work diligently to apprehend the individuals responsible for this heinous crime.
